Heart transplantation is a complex surgical procedure that involves the replacement of a diseased or damaged heart with a healthy heart from a donor who has recently died. The primary aim of heart transplantation is to restore normal heart function in patients suffering from end-stage heart failure, which can result from various conditions, including coronary artery disease, cardiomyopathy, and valvular heart disease. The procedure is typically recommended when other treatment options, such as medication and less invasive surgeries, have failed to improve the patient's quality of life or prognosis. Before being considered for transplantation, a comprehensive evaluation is conducted to assess the patient's overall health, psychological stability, and suitability for receiving a donor heart. This evaluation also includes various diagnostic tests, imaging studies, and consultations with specialists to ensure that the patient can withstand the rigors of surgery and the subsequent demands of post-operative recovery. Once a patient is placed on the transplant waiting list, they are monitored closely for any changes in their condition, sometimes being placed on various medical therapies to manage symptoms and maintain function as best as possible until a compatible donor heart becomes available. The allocation of donor organs is managed by national or regional transplant organizations based on several factors, including the severity of the recipient's condition, blood type compatibility, body size, and the geographical proximity of the donor. Transplantation surgery itself involves making a large incision in the chest to access the heart and remove the diseased heart. The donor heart is carefully prepared and then connected to the major blood vessels that surround the heart to ensure proper blood circulation. After the grafting process is complete, the surgeon will monitor the heart's function and may also implant various devices, such as pacemakers, to support the heart's rhythm and function as it adapts to its new environment. Following the surgery, patients typically remain in the hospital for several days to weeks for monitoring and recovery, during which they receive medications to prevent organ rejection and manage any potential complications, such as infection or bleeding. Patients undergo regular follow-up visits to ensure the heart is functioning properly and to assess for signs of rejection or other issues. Life after a heart transplant involves a rigorous commitment to medication adherence and lifestyle changes, including following a heart-healthy diet, engaging in regular exercise, and attending ongoing medical appointments. The success of heart transplantation can be remarkable, with many patients experiencing significant improvements in quality of life, increased physical activity levels, and extended longevity. However, the procedure also comes with risks, including organ rejection and complications from long-term immunosuppression therapy. Despite these challenges, heart transplantation remains one of the most effective treatments for end-stage heart failure, offering hope and a new lease on life for patients who might otherwise face dire outcomes.
